Comprehensive Guide to Nevada Records Request

What is the Nevada Public Records Request Form?

The Nevada Public Records Request Form serves as a formal instrument for individuals seeking access to various public records in the state of Nevada. This form is essential for outlining the specific records customers wish to access, which includes documents related to public lending and other public affairs. The State of Nevada Division of Mortgage Lending holds the authority to process these requests, ensuring transparency and accountability in governance.
Individuals can request multiple types of records, including financial documents, transaction histories, and any other relevant public data. This form acts as a gateway for citizens to engage with their government through informed inquiries.

Submission Methods and Delivery for the Nevada Public Records Request Form

Once the Nevada Public Records Request Form is filled out, requesters have several submission options available. These include submitting the form online, mailing it, or delivering it in person to the appropriate office.
After submission, users should anticipate a response time, which can vary depending on the request's complexity and the office's current processing workload. It's essential to check for updates regarding your request and be aware of any potential fees that may apply during this process.
